Linux 内核时钟架构之时钟源设备注册

    /**  * __clocksource_register_scale - Used to install new clocksources  * @cs:  clocksource to be registered  * @scale: Scale factor multiplied against freq to get clocksource hz  * @freq: clocksource frequency (cycles per second) divided by scale  *  * Returns -EBUSY if registration fails, zero otherwise.  *  * This *SHOULD NOT* be called directly! Please use the  * clocksource_register_hz() or clocksource_register_khz helper functions.  */ int __clocksource_register_scale(struct clocksource *cs, u32 scale, u32 freq) {

     /* Initialize mult/shift and max_idle_ns */  __clocksource_update_freq_scale(cs, scale, freq);

     /* Add clocksource to the clocksource list */  mutex_lock(&clocksource_mutex);  clocksource_enqueue(cs);  clocksource_enqueue_watchdog(cs);  clocksource_select();  clocksource_select_watchdog(false);  mutex_unlock(&clocksource_mutex);  return 0; } EXPORT_SYMBOL_GPL(__clocksource_register_scale);
